Some Questions for President Bush

Under the "Advise and Consent" provision of the Constitution, the Senate has the right and the duty to hold public televised inquiries to ask the following of President Bush while under oath:

  1. Is it not true that in a January 31, 2003 press conference Adam Boulton of Sky News (London) asked: "Do you believe that there is a link, a direct link, between Saddam Hussein and the men who attacked on September the 11th?" and that you replied "I can't make that claim."

     

  2. Is it not true that Osami bin Laden is a Saudi Arabia national and Muslim fundamentalist? What evidence is there that Saddam Hussein has ever provided direct support to Muslim fundamentalist governments?

     

  3. Did you then or do you now have any evidence of a direct link between Saddam Hussein and the September 11 attack? If so, what is it?

     

  4. If you had overwhelming evidence, as you claimed, that Iraq had weapons of mass destruction, why, after several months of U. N. inspections and a continuing war, have none ever been found? In the desperate struggle of the Iraqi military against American invaders, is it not reasonable to assume that Saddam Hussein would have used weapons of mass destruction if he had indeed possessed them? Yet not a single chemical, biological, or nuclear weapon was used against U. S. forces. How do you explain that?

     

  5. Please explain exactly how American involvement in the Iraq war has provided increased protection for United States citizens against terrorist attack.
